Zindagi Trust is a non-profit 501(c)3 philanthropic organization that aims to provide quality education to the underprivileged children of Pakistan. It has established 29 operational schools with over 2800 children currently being educated across Pakistan. Additionally, Zindagi Trust is committed to promoting quality Government school reform and improving the curriculum and textbooks of the education system of Pakistan. Zindagi Trust along with the Book Group was successful in the remarkable transformation of Fatimah Girls Government School in Karachi where 2500 students are enrolled … (about 1/2).
